One key psychological factor is the idea of scarcity. When purchasers perceive that something is limited in availability, they are more likely to desire it. Marketers can leverage this by creating a sense of urgency or highlighting the exclusivity of their items. Another powerful principle is social proof, which states that people are more likely to believe something if they see others doing it.

  • Testimonials
  • Proven results

By showcasing the positive experiences of others, marketers can foster trust and assurance in their brand. Furthermore, understanding cognitive biases can help marketers to craft more effective messaging. For example, the anchoring bias can be utilized by presenting a high initial price before offering a lower one, making the latter seem like a bargain.

One key aspect of understanding customer behavior is analyzing website activity. Tools like heatmaps and scroll depth reveal how users navigate your site, highlighting areas where interest and potential drop-off points. This information can then be used improve website design, content placement, and calls to action for a more captivating user journey.

  • Additionally, personalized recommendations based on browsing history and past purchases can significantly enhance conversion rates. By showing relevant products, e-commerce platforms can cater to individual customer needs and desires, making them much likely to make a purchase.
  • In contrast, optimizing the checkout process is crucial for converting potential buyers. A streamlined checkout experience with clear instructions, multiple payment options, and secure transactions can minimize cart abandonment rates and boost overall conversion success.
